On Saturday, December 27, we brought some life back into the C-97.
After long preparations, hoses being changed, plugs, compression tests, and a plethora of other items, we drug her outside and fired her up.
Report: Everything seems fine SO FAR. We ran #1, 2, and 4 engines. #3 is still awaiting some propeller work before we try her.
But.. So far, we have a new gripe list to work from. Some instrumentation is inop, and the #2 cowl flaps arent working right, but other than that, we are happy with the results.
I posted some photos and video on WIX Facebook, and a few other groups. These are crude and shot with my iPhone from the cockpit.
A better series of media will be released soon.
So, at the moment, we have 3 running R-4360s. One to go....
Our next steps are getting #3 engine prepped for start, then getting satisfied with their performance and the items on the ‘gripe sheet’ are addressed satisfactorily.
This is a monumental step for this program, but we still have many obstacles to overcome before flight.

There are 3 videos contained in this link, We actually started #4 first, so that's the long process trying to get it going. Contrary to what the 'experts' have said on FB, we were not yet in danger of burning up the starter. Close, but we were within limits. The other #4 video was just prior to shutdown. The last video was, I believe, the 30 inch check on #1. I did not video #2, as I was running out of room on my iPhone. I can tell you that while it took a little while to start #4, #1 and #2 lit up as if though they had been run earlier in the day. (Not too bad considering it had been 12 years).... enjoy!
